Walking Tacos

Walking tacos don't have to be a treat you only enjoy at the ballpark! Switch up your next taco night with this fun, kid friendly meal you'll love!
Prep Time15 minutes
Cook Time20 minutes
Total Time35 minutes
Course: Dinner, Entree, Main Course
Cuisine: American, Tex Mex
Servings: 4
Calories: 1416kcal

Ingredients

  • 1 lb. Ground beef
  • 1 Onion peeled and diced
  • 2 cups salsa your choice of heat level or tomato sauce
  • 3 tbsp taco seasoning
  • 1 15 oz can black or red beans rinsed and drained
  • Salt and ground black pepper to taste
  • ¼ cup chopped cilantro or fresh parsley

Toppings

  • Shredded cheddar cheese or cheese sauce recipe follows
  • Sour cream optional
  • Green onions sliced
  • 4 Small bags
  • Fritos corn chips

For The Cheese Sauce

  • 1 Tablespoon butter
  • 2 Tablespoons all purpose flour
  • 1 1/2 cups milk
  • 1 1/2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
  • Salt and ground black pepper to taste

Instructions

  • To make the cheese sauce, melt the butter in a large skillet and stir in the
  • all purpose flour. Cook on low heat for a couple of minutes. Slowly whisk in the milk and continue cooking for a few minutes until all the lumps are gone and the mixture begins to thicken.
  • Stir in the shredded cheese until melted and add salt and ground black pepper to taste.
  • Add the ground beef to a large skillet or cast iron pan and cook on medium low heat for a few minutes. Use a
  • spatula to break up the meat.
  • Add the diced onion and continue cooking and stirring for a few more minutes until the meat begins to brown.
  • Stir in the salsa or tomato sauce along with the taco seasoning and beans. Continue cooking on low heat, stirring
  • occasionally, for another 5 to 10 minutes. Taste and add salt and pepper as needed.
  • Stir in the chopped cilantro or parsley and remove from the heat.
  • To serve, set up a bowl with the beef and bean mixture along with bowls of the chopped green onions, sour
  • cream and the cheese sauce as well as small packages of Fritos chips.
  • Spoon the beef and bean mixture over the chips in the bag, pour on some cheese sauce, top with green onions
  • and sour cream and enjoy. Alternately, you can pour the Fritos into a bowl and add the toppings.
